Abstract
A system and method comprise a spectrum selector, an unlicensed transceiver, and a licensed transceiver. The spectrum selector determines whether communications will be transmitted over unlicensed spectrum or licensed spectrum. Based upon the determination, the spectrum selector transmits the communications to the unlicensed transceiver or the licensed transceiver. In addition, the spectrum selector may transmit a first portion of the communications to the unlicensed transceiver and a second portion of the communications to the licensed transceiver. On the receiving side, the spectrum selector monitors the unlicensed transceiver and the licensed transceiver, receives the communications from the licensed transceiver and/or the unlicensed transceiver, and transmits the communications to an access device. The unlicensed transceiver transmits and/or receives communications over unlicensed spectrum. The licensed transceiver transmits and/or receives communications over licensed spectrum.
